viewer = new TableViewer(table);
viewer.setLabelProvider(new LabelProvider());
logContentProvider = new LogContentProvider(viewer) {
+ private static final long serialVersionUID = -3401776448301180724L;
@Override
protected StringBuffer prefix(String username, Long timestamp,
/** A content provider maintaining an array of lines */
class LogContentProvider implements ILazyContentProvider, ArgeoLogListener {
+ private static final long serialVersionUID = -2084872367738339721L;
+
private DateFormat dateFormat = new SimpleDateFormat("HH:mm:ss");
private final Long start;
}
private class RolesContentProvider implements IStructuredContentProvider {
+ private static final long serialVersionUID = -4576917440167866233L;
+
public Object[] getElements(Object inputElement) {
return new TreeSet<String>(CurrentUser.roles()).toArray();
}